How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Alvadore?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Alvadore Studio Apartments | $1,629 | $695 | $3,479 |
Alvadore 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,781 | $980 | $3,650 |
Alvadore 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,046 | $965 | $5,384 |
Alvadore 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,405 | $699 | $4,186 |
Alvadore 4 Bedroom Apartments | $705 | $650 | $750 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Alvadore
How much are Studio apartments in Alvadore?
There are currently 10 Studio Apartments in Alvadore with rent ranges from $695 to $3,479 with an average price of $1,629.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Alvadore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Alvadore ranges from $980 to $3,650 with an average monthly rent of $1,781.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Alvadore c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Alvadore range from $965 to $5,384.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,046.
How expensive are Alvadore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 19 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Alvadore on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$699 to $4,186 - averaging $2,405 for the location.
